Once upon a time, two friends Stephen Giraffe and Peter Rabbit used to live in Southern Silverwood Forest. They stayed nearby and also studied in the same school - "Silverwood Junior School".
On one spring afternoon, with cool winds and fresh air, both were playing in a playground near their house.
They were sliding, swinging and running around.
After some time, Stephen felt hungry.
He told Peter, 'Let us have some icecream and chocolate chips cookies from Uncle David Bear's shop.'
Peter : 'No Stephen. IceCreams and chocolate chip cookies are not good. We can go to our homes, have some fruits and come back here.'
'No, I want those two things. I want them...!'
'Stephen, please think wisely. Having these things too frequently is not good for our health!'
'Peter you are not a good friend. Else you would have readily came with me.
Well, I should go alone there.'
'Stephen. Listen.....'
However, Stephen doesn't listens and starts walking towards Uncle David Bear's shop.
